Build vs Buy: Streamed Widget Rendering for Scalable Frontend Architectures
Deciding whether to build or buy streamed widget rendering infrastructure is critical for operations teams managing complex frontend architectures. This guide examines key technical and operational factors.
Understanding Streamed Widget Rendering: Core Technical Boundaries
Streamed widget rendering enables efficient delivery of dynamic interface components through incremental frames, reducing initial payload sizes and improving perceived performance. For operations leaders, defining clear render boundaries is essential to isolate widget logic, manage state synchronization, and maintain security perimeters. When building in-house, teams must engineer robust streaming protocols that handle partial updates, error recovery, and resource constraints across diverse devices. This approach grants full customization but demands significant investment in infrastructure reliability, monitoring systems, and cross-team coordination to sustain operator trust at scale.
When to Buy: Prioritizing Operator Trust and Operational Efficiency
Purchasing a mature streamed widget rendering platform allows operations teams to accelerate deployment while leveraging proven incremental frame delivery and hardened security models. Vendor solutions often include built-in observability, automated boundary management, and compliance-ready features that reduce operational overhead. Key evaluation criteria include integration depth with existing generative UI pipelines, latency SLAs, and support for fine-grained trust controls. Buying frees engineering resources from undifferentiated streaming infrastructure work, enabling focus on business-specific logic and faster iteration cycles without compromising reliability or visibility.
What are render boundaries in streamed widget rendering?
Render boundaries define isolated scopes for widget updates, preventing cascading re-renders and enabling targeted incremental frames. They support secure, independent streaming of UI components while maintaining overall application stability.
How does incremental frame delivery impact operator trust?
Incremental frames provide predictable, low-latency updates with clear audit trails. This transparency and reliability build confidence in the system's performance and security, especially in mission-critical operational environments.
This article is part of the StreamCanvas editorial stream: daily original content around production generative UI, interface architecture, and safe AI delivery.